Cerro del Parrado
Cerro del Parrado is a peak in Istán, Málaga, Andalusia and has an elevation of 708 metres. Cerro del Parrado is situated nearby to the locality Cerro Parralo, as well as near Llano Chico.Places of Interest

Istán
Village

Istán is a town and municipality in the province of Málaga in Andalusia in southern Spain with an estimated population in 2005 of 1400 people. It lies beneath the Sierra Blanca in the valley of the Rio Verde about 15 km to the northwest from Marbella and the Mediterranean coast.
